About William A. Holohan

  • William A.
  • Holohan is a former justice of the Arizona Supreme Court, serving from 1972 until his retirement in 1989.
  • Holohan served as Chief Justice from 1982 to 1987.Holohan served as an Assistant United States Attorney to then–United States Attorney Jack D.
  • H.
  • Hays.
  • Holohan was considered conservative in his legal and political views but progressive in judicial reform. In 1988, Holohan wrote the opinion of the court in Green v.
  • Osborne, a 4-1 decision that canceled a recall election for Evan Mecham because Mecham already had been impeached and removed as governor." Other notable opinions include a "1982 reversal of a lower-court ruling that declared Arizona Downs' lease at Turf Paradise to be unconstitutional and a violation of antitrust laws."
